Herunterladen Diese Seite drucken

Bosch Rexroth IndraDrive Bedienungsanleitung Seite 114

Werbung

112/249
Bosch Rexroth AG
Rexroth IndraDrive-Firmware-Bibliotheken
MX_fHighResTimerTicks_to_us
Eingangs-Variable
HighResTimerTicks
Rückgabewert
MX_fHighResTimerTicks_to_us
MX_IECTaskGetLoad
Die
Firmware-Funktion
Timerticks in Mikrosekunden umzuwandeln und den Wert als REAL
zurückzuliefern.
In welcher Bibliothek die Funktion verfügbar ist, sehen Sie hier:
"Bibliothekszuordnung für die Zielsysteme "IndraDrive MPH02"
und "IndraDrive
Zielsystem "IndraDrive
Abb. 1-49:
Firmware-Funktion "MX_fHighResTimerTicks_to_us"
Datentyp
Beschreibung
UDINT
Übergabewerte sind Timerticks (siehe z. B. "MX_fGetHighResTime")
Tab. 1-119:
Eingangs-Variable der Firmware-Funktion "MX_fHighResTimer‐
Ticks_to_us"
Datentyp
Beschreibung
REAL
Liefert die Timerticks in μs zurück
Tab. 1-120:
Rückgabewert der Firmware-Funktion "MX_fHighResTimer‐
Ticks_to_us"
Der Funktionsbaustein "MX_IECTaskGetLoad" dient dazu die erweiterte
Laufzeitmessung
zu
Taskbelastung an (siehe auch Anwendungsbeschreibung zu IndraMotion
MLD, Kapitel "Laufzeitmessungen").
Sobald eine Bausteininstanz im Projekt angelegt ist, wird die
erweiterte Laufzeitmessung im Antrieb aktiviert. Diese kann nur in
der Firmware MPH (nicht MPB) aktiviert werden.
Der Funktionsbaustein "MX_IECTaskGetLoad" kann in der
"eigenen" Task, aber auch in einer anderen (langsameren) Task
aufgerufen werden, um Rechenzeit zu sparen. Die maximale
Taskbelastung wir auch gemessen, wenn der Baustein nicht in
jedem Zyklus aufgerufen wird.
In welcher Bibliothek die Funktion verfügbar ist, sehen Sie hier:
"Bibliothekszuordnung ab dem Zielsystem "IndraDrive
DOK-INDRV*-MLD-SYSLIB*-FK07-DE-P
Rexroth IndraDrive Rexroth IndraMotion MLD Bibliothek
"MX_fHighResTimerTicks_to_us"
MP03"" bzw. hier
"Bibliothekszuordnung ab dem
MP04""
aktivieren
und
zeigt
dient
dazu,
Informationen
über
die
MP04""

Werbung

loading

Diese Anleitung auch für:

Rexroth indramotion mld